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ad Ingredients

For the Salad
Pasta – Choose any type, like fusilli or penne, to create a hearty base; gluten-free options work beautifully too.
Basil Pesto – This is essential for that rich flavor; feel free to use store-bought or whip up your own for a fresher taste.
Fresh Mozzarella – Its creamy texture complements the other ingredients; consider using burrata if you’re craving extra creaminess.
Cherry Tomatoes – Their sweetness and juiciness brighten up the dish; halved cherry tomatoes are easy to eat and look great.
Fresh Basil (optional) – A sprinkle enhances freshness and visual charm; omit it only if you must, but it boosts the flavor.
Salt & Pepper – Essential for seasoning; adjust to your liking for the perfect taste balance.

For Customization (optional)
Grilled Chicken – Adding this protein turns the salad into a complete meal, making it heartier and more filling.
Olives – A handful can introduce a briny surprise that balances the flavors beautifully.
Roasted Vegetables – Toss in favorites like zucchini or bell peppers for added texture and nutrition.

How to Make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ad

  1. Cook Pasta: Boil your chosen pasta according to the package instructions until al dente, usually about 8-10 minutes. Drain and let it cool completely to prevent sticking.

  2. Combine Ingredients: In a spacious bowl, mix the cooled pasta with halved cherry tomatoes and fresh mozzarella balls. This vibrant base brings color and texture to your salad.

  3. Stir in Pesto: Gently fold in the basil pesto, ensuring that every piece of pasta is generously coated. The rich, green pesto will infuse the salad with its delightful flavors.

  4. Season: Sprinkle with salt and pepper, adjusting to taste. Remember, seasoning is key to elevating the overall flavor of your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ad!

  5. Garnish and Serve: Add fresh basil on top for a pop of color and aromatic freshness, if desired. Serve chilled or at room temperature for maximum enjoyment!

Optional: Drizzle with balsamic glaze for an extra layer of sweetness.

How to Store and Freeze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ad

  • Fridge: Store any le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days. This lets the flavors continue to meld, making each bite even more delicious!

  • Freezer: For longer storage, you can freeze the pasta salad without the fresh mozzarella and tomatoes. It will keep well for up to 2 months. When ready to eat, thaw in the fridge overnight and add fresh ingredients before serving.

  • Reheating: If enjoying leftovers, it’s best to serve the salad cold or at room temperature. If you prefer warm pasta, gently heat it on the stovetop with a splash of olive oil—don’t forget to mix in fresh mozzarella and tomatoes after warming!

  • Serving Tip: Always taste and adjust seasoning before serving leftovers, as flavors may intensify while stored. This ensures your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ad remains just as delightful as when you first made it!

Make Ahead Options

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ad is an ideal choice for meal prep, saving you precious time on busy days. You can prepare the pasta, cherry tomatoes, and mozzarella up to 24 hours in advance, storing them separ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ator to maintain their freshness. To enjoy this delicious dish later, simply combine all ingredients, including the basil pesto, just before serving to ensure every bite bursts with flavor. If you’re concerned about the salad becoming too soggy, keep the pesto separate until you’re ready to enjoy your salad.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ad Recipe FAQs

What type of pasta should I use for the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ad?
Absolutely! You can use any type of pasta for this dish—fusilli, penne, or even gluten-free varieties work beautifully. For a heartier salad, choose a shape that holds the pesto well, like farfalle or rotini.

How should I store leftovers of the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ad?
Store your leftover salad in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. The flavors actually improve as they meld together! If you’d like to keep it longer, it’s best to freeze the pasta salad without the fresh mozzarella and cherry tomatoes, as these don’t freeze well.

Can I freeze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ad?
Yes, you can freeze the pasta salad, but omit the fresh ingredients like mozzarella and tomatoes. To freeze, prepare the salad and store it in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. When you’re ready to eat, simply thaw it overnight in the fridge, then mix in fresh mozzarella and tomatoes just before serving.

How do I troubleshoot common issues, like overcooked pasta?
If you’ve accidentally overcooked your pasta, don’t fret! You can try to revive it by rinsing the pasta under cold water to stop the cooking process and cool it down quickly. For future reference, always aim for al dente pasta, which means it should be firm to the bite, ensuring it holds its shape in the salad.

Are there any dietary considerations for the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ad?
Great question! If you’re making this dish for a gathering where guests might have allergies or dietary preferences, be sure to check the pesto ingredients, as some brands may contain nuts. Additionally, you can easily make this salad vegan by using a dairy-free pesto and omitting the mozzarella. Don’t hesitate to customize with proteins or veggies to cater to various dietary needs!

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ad: Your Go-To Fresh Summer Delight

A refreshing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ad that combines al dente pasta, cherry tomatoes, mozzarella, and flavorful basil pesto for a perfect summer dish.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Chilling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: PASTA
Cuisine: Italian
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Salad
  • 2 cups Pasta Any type, such as fusilli or penne, gluten-free options work beautifully.
  • 1 cup Basil Pesto Store-bought or homemade.
  • 8 oz Fresh Mozzarella Consider using burrata for extra creaminess.
  • 1 cup Cherry Tomatoes Halved.
  • 1 cup Fresh Basil Optional, enhances freshness.
  • to taste Salt & Pepper Essential for seasoning.
For Customization (optional)
  • 1 cup Grilled Chicken Adds protein to make it a complete meal.
  • 1/2 cup Olives For a briny surprise.
  • 1 cup Roasted Vegetables Like zucchini or bell peppers.

Equipment

  • large pot
  • Mixing Bowl

Method
 

How to Make Pesto Caprese Pasta Salad
  1. Boil your chosen pasta according to the package instructions until al dente, usually about 8-10 minutes. Drain and let it cool completely to prevent sticking.
  2. In a spacious bowl, mix the cooled pasta with halved cherry tomatoes and fresh mozzarella balls.
  3. Gently fold in the basil pesto, ensuring that every piece of pasta is generously coated.
  4. Sprinkle with salt and pepper, adjusting to taste.
  5. Add fresh basil on top for a pop of color and aromatic freshness, if desired.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
